Cody Gakpo Makes Liverpool Exit Decision as Manchester City Move Edges Closer

Cody Gakpo appears to have made his choice.

With the transfer deadline approaching on Tuesday, the Liverpool forward has reportedly turned down Tottenham in favour of a move to Manchester City, with negotiations now underway between the relevant parties.

The 27-year-old has attracted interest from both Premier League clubs this summer, but it now appears that a switch to north London is not the destination he wants.

Gakpo chooses Manchester City

Tottenham had remained interested in Gakpo despite recently completing deals for Manchester City pair Savio and Omar Marmoush.

However, the Dutchman is reportedly not keen on moving to Spurs and has instead opted for a move to City, where he would work under Enzo Maresca.

Talks are now understood to be taking place as the clubs attempt to reach an agreement before the window closes.

Gakpo joined Liverpool from PSV in December 2022 in a deal reported to be worth £37million.

Since arriving at Anfield, he has established himself as an important member of the squad, registering 50 goals and 23 assists in 180 appearances across all competitions.

His current Liverpool contract runs until 2030, having signed a new five-year agreement only last year.

Gakpo still contributing for Liverpool

Despite the transfer speculation, Gakpo continued to feature for Liverpool in their latest Premier League fixture.

He started Saturday’s 2-2 draw with Nottingham Forest on the right flank and provided an assist as Liverpool fought back from behind.
